Description

The Life of a celebrated Fool for Christ's sake in sixth-century Syria, written by Leontius, Bishop of Neapolis in Cyprus, who also wrote the life of Saint John the Almsgiver. A very edifying life, filled with the colorful exploits of a Fool for Christ's sake, a form of asceticism – in fact one of the highest forms of asceticism – that the Introduction to the book explains. — Publisher's Description
